Adam's Apples (Adams æbler)

Anders Thomas Jensen's (writer of 'Brothers', and New Zealand favourite 'After the Wedding') 2005 black comedy.

"That this wicked black comedy is written and directed by Anders Thomas Jensen, the writer of 'Brothers' should be reason enough to recommend it. That it's an often side-splittingly funny - yet also thoughtful - fable on the nature of good and evil featuring a spectacularly grumpy Neo-Nazi (Ulrich Thomsen) and an irksome priest (the brilliant Mads Mikkelsen - virtually unrecognisable after his skinhead in the Pusher films elsewhere on our program) is yet another. The plot? Adam, an ex-con, is sent to serve out his community service at the church centre run by the earnest Ivan, who sets him a task: to bake an apple pie. Sounds easy but it proves anything but."
